Development stages
01
Interview and analytics
Development begins with the definition of the business goal and business task of the Customer. Then we analyze the Client's information environment and current business processes.
02
Compiling a technical specification
Based on the information obtained at the previous stage, the requirements of the Customer and our own capabilities, we draw up a TOR. It describes the technical requirements and all functional modules, approves the procedure for registration and acceptance of the result.
03
Prototyping
Next, we move on to prototyping – we visualize the future product according to the requirements of the Customer and the analysis carried out, build the page structure for visual presentation and create interactive prototypes.
04
Design development
Design work begins with the definition of the overall visual concept and style of the product being developed. For the presentation, we are preparing a demonstration of the interface elements, as well as showing all the animations that will be used in the future.
05
Frontend and Backend development
For each project, we individually select developers with the appropriate level and technology stack. Everything that was thought up in the previous stages is now implemented in the form of code.
06
Testing
An important step in creating a quality product is testing. During testing, a thorough check of the site for its performance is carried out, as well as prompt elimination of all errors.
07
Project Transfer
After completing all the stages of developing and creating a product, we transfer it to the Customer – we demonstrate all the functionality and common parts of the web resource. In addition, we provide training for employees of the Client's company.
08
Support
We form a separate category for requests from the Customer's employees regarding the functioning of the product. Upon additional requests of the Client, we organize server monitoring, up-to-date software support, and a backup system.

How can the effectiveness of a landing page be increased?
To enhance the effectiveness of a landing page, it's essential to have a clear understanding of your target audience (TA) in order to develop UX/UI, as well as creatives and lead magnets tailored to the patterns of potential clients.
5.
Who needs a landing page?
In most cases, landing page development is aimed at presenting one specific product or service for a specific target audience.
6.
How to test the effectiveness of a Landing Page?
To check the effectiveness of the Landing Page, you should use analytical tools such as Yandex.Metrica and Google Analytics to track the number of visitors, their actions, and other indicators.
